Plastic Surgery For Men

It is a common misunderstanding that plastic surgery is primarily for women.  While statistics show that the majority of cosmetic procedures are performed on women, men are increasingly taking advantage of the benefits of plastic surgery. The American Society of Plastic Surgeons (ASPS) estimated that over 1.3 million aesthetic procedures were performed on men alone […]

Why is it Called “Plastic” Surgery?

What is “Plastic” About Plastic Surgery? Plastic surgery has been around for a long time– about 5000 years, in fact. Even the name “plastic surgery” has been around for nearly 140 years: long before plastic was invented (the material “Bakelite” was developed in 1909), and certainly well before silicone was around.
